ShareAssystem is an international company with one mission: accelerate the energy transition around the world. Every day, our 8,000 switchers located in 12 countries (Europe, Middle East, Pacific Asia & Africa) connect their six thousand billion neurons to tackle the task of the century: switching to low-carbon energy. We are a collective committed to the actors who are making the energy switch. Sharing our knowledge, expertise and values allows us to innovate and think differently about the energy transition. Drawing on more than 55 years’ experience in highly regulated sectors subject to strict security and safety requirements, we provide our customers with engineering and project management services, as well as digital services and solutions to optimize the performance of complex infrastructure projects throughout their life cycle. The Group is currently ranked second in the world for nuclear engineering. To ensure a viable, efficient, and reliable energy future for all.
Join Our Team! We’re Recruiting for a Dynamic Recruiter! As a key player in our recruitment function, you’ll work closely with recruiting managers and the broader team to take full ownership of the end-to-end recruitment process for a variety of roles. You’ll be managing 15+ vacancies at different stages of sourcing, selection, and onboarding.
Key Responsibilities:
- Initial Role Briefing: Conducting initial meetings with recruiting managers to understand role requirements.
- Candidate Sourcing & Screening: Finding suitable candidates and conducting initial telephone screenings.
- Interview Coordination: Arranging interviews between candidates and recruiting managers.
- Offer Management: Handling the offer process for selected candidates.
- Compliance: Ensuring adherence to both client and Assystem processes, legislation, and company policies.
- ATS Management: Accurately recording vacancy and candidate details within the ATS system.
You’ll be an amazing recruiter with a deep understanding of the complete recruitment cycle, including:
- Undertaking role briefs
- Sourcing
- Interviewing
- Offer management
- Onboarding
You’ll be working within a dynamic, fast-paced environment, so you’ll need to be comfortable working at speed while ensuring accuracy is never compromised. The ability to juggle multiple tasks simultaneously is essential!
Since most of the roles you will be recruiting are engineering and infrastructure-based, it would be ideal if you have experience in one of the following sectors:
- Power Generation
- Transportation Infrastructure
- Engineering
- Utilities
- Construction/Facilities
Due to the nature of work to be undertaken applicants will be required to meet certain residency criteria in order to attain a minimum level of UK security clearance if not already security cleared to a minimum SC level.
